For our big competition of the night, we divided the girls into two teams for CUPCAKE WARS!!!

Amy and I had found a fun recipe - for cupcakes, you simply need to combine one can of pop with one boxed cake mix. That's it! No eggs....no oil....just delicious fizzy-ness! Bake at 350 degrees for 20 minutes. (Seemed to make an average of 16 - 18 cupcakes)



Amy and I tried a fun combination the night before. Using a strawberry cake mix and sprite, we made strawberry limeade cupcakes!
